immediately fix whatever it is that is causing the mold buy more insurance in case it happens again in the future for the past, do the best you can with the $10,000 from the insurance you have, assuming they have already been notified by you and they have looked at the damage and agreed to pay you the $10,000 you mentioned your AC was worked on while you were gone, was whoever worked on your AC negligent in not properly fixing the AC and is that why you have the mold, if you current damages are more than the $10,000 the insurance should pay you, you may have a claim against your AC company
